What are some common challenges faced in a Remote Linux Desktop Support role, and how can they be managed effectively?

A common challenge in Remote Linux Desktop Support is troubleshooting issues without physical access to the user's device, which can make hardware-related problems more difficult to diagnose. Additionally, users may have highly customized environments, requiring support professionals to adapt quickly to various Linux distributions and configurations. Effective communication is crucial, as clear instructions help users resolve issues remotely. Staying updated on the latest Linux tools and remote management solutions also greatly enhances problem-solving efficiency and user satisfaction.

What is a Remote Linux Desktop Support specialist?

A Remote Linux Desktop Support specialist is an IT professional who provides technical assistance and troubleshooting for Linux-based desktop systems, often working remotely. Their responsibilities include resolving software, hardware, and network issues, installing and updating Linux distributions, and guiding users through technical problems via remote tools. They may also help with system optimization, security updates, and user account management. These specialists often support end-users, businesses, or teams utilizing Linux operating systems in their daily workflow. Strong communication skills and in-depth knowledge of various Linux distributions are essential for this role.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Remote Linux Desktop Support specialist,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Remote Linux Desktop Support specialist, you need strong knowledge of Linux operating systems, troubleshooting skills, and experience with user support, often backed by relevant certifications like CompTIA Linux+ or LPIC-1. Familiarity with remote desktop tools, ticketing systems, and command-line utilities is essential for effectively resolving technical issues. Excellent communication, patience, and problem-solving abilities help you deliver clear support and build trust with remote users. These skills ensure efficient resolution of incidents, high user satisfaction, and reliable system performance in distributed work environments.

Northrop Grumman Aeronautics Systems is currently seeking a Consulting Cyber Systems Engineer to join our team of qualified, diverse individuals. The selected candidate will be supporting multiple programs/sites under our Manufacturing Engineering & Technology Organization and will be located in Palmdale, CA, Dayton, OH, San Diego, CA, Melbourne, FL, or Hybrid.
Position is eligible for full-time remote.
Pay Range: Will be dependent on the location of the selected candidate.
We're looking for a highly motivated, team oriented, individual that understands security and the importance to our mission. The candidate will be responsible for the secure operations infrastructure, platforms, and software, including the installation, maintenance, and improvement of environments. The candidate will act as a Cyber Subject Matter Expert (SME) and ensure compliance with multiple directives, such as the Risk Management Framework and NSA CSfC Capability Packages.
Responsibilities:
  • Perform technical planning, system integration, verification and validation, cost and risk, and supportability and effectiveness analyses for National Security Agency (NSA) Commercial Solutions for Classified (CSfC) programs.
  • Align architectures with NSA Capability Packages to include developing cyber solutions for Data-in-Transit (DiT) while integrating commercial products such as VPNs, firewalls, and encryption layers.
  • Integrate and validate layered commercial-off-the-shelf (COTS) components to include configuring Public Key Infrastructure (PKI), automating deployment of DevSecOps secure pipelines, and support interoperability testing across multi-enclave environments.
  • Provide advanced technical analyses of cyber infrastructure challenges and problems; develop/identify technical solutions responsive to customer and program needs.
  • Participate in team reviews of technical requirements, design and implementation plans prior to deployment.
  • Recommend and implement system enhancements that will improve the performance, reliability, and security of the system including installing, upgrading, monitoring, problem resolution, and configuration.
  • Serve as a Cyber SME supporting on CSfC capability packages for stakeholders, to include leading technical exchange meetings, working groups with government customers, translating operational needs into scalable, production ready secure architectures, and mentoring engineers in advanced CSfC concepts. Support the continuous assessment of IA Control compliance for systems within their responsibility.

Basic Qualifications:
  • Bachelor's of Science, Technology, Engineering or Mathematics (STEM) degree with 20 years of technical experience in any combination of Cyber, Systems, Security, Software, or Hardware disciplines OR Master's of STEM degree with 18 years of technical experience in any combination of Cyber, Systems, Security, Software, or Hardware disciplines.
  • Active, In-Scope, DOD Secret Security Clearance or higher that has been granted / renewed within the past 6 years.
  • The ability to obtain and maintain Special Program Access.

Preferred Qualifications:
  • DoD 8500-series and 8510.01 IA policy directives, approaches to cyber security, knowledge of security procedures, IATT and ATO requirements.
  • Excellent communication (written and oral), negotiation and interpersonal skills necessary to support known activities/challenges working with engineering teams, management, customers, partners and government.
  • Experience with Dell, Cisco, Palo Alto, Aruba and other next generation switches and firewalls.
  • Experience translating technical concepts and program information to others.
  • Solid understanding of planning, design, and implementation necessary to support a large enterprise system.
  • Working knowledge of NIST 800-37 RMF body of evidence artifacts such as SSP, SCTM, PoA&M's, SAR, RAR, RAL, ConOps, ISA, etc.
  • Experience with configuring Security Incident Event Monitoring and IDS/IPS tools such as ACAS, ESS (HBSS), and Splunk on Linux RedHat and Windows environments.
  • Experience with vulnerability and compliance scanners such as Tenable.SC and SCAP.
  • Experience with CDS technology, security, and compliance requirements.
  • Experience in preparing and/or reviewing technical and programmatic documentation.
